How the 1921 Election Worked in Context

The New South Wales Legislative Assembly elections held in 1921 reflected a complex political landscape shaped by post-WWI economic shifts, evolving party alignments, and growing urban-rural divides. The Coalition, a seated majority aligned with conservative and agrarian interests, retained its mandate through strategic seat retention and coalition support. Yet, opposition forces gained ground, stoking debate over policy direction and public accountability. Though the tally maintained coalition strength, emerging strong challenger voices signaled shifting allegiances rarely seen in stable once-ruling blocks. The result was not a defeat, but a quiet warning: stability required constant reengagement.
